In file-sharing, piracy, and archiving communities, a repack refers to a digital file (such as a game, movie, or software suite) that has been compressed, fixed, or re-released. Repacks are designed to: Reduce download sizes for users with slow internet. Fix bugs or missing data found in the original upload. Include pre-installed updates, cracks, or modifications.
